This is the Kubota Shop Manual for the 03-M Series diesel engines, publication number 9Y011-02132. It runs 125 pages with a full text layer and covers the D1503-M, D1703-M, D1803-M, V2203-M, and V2403-M, including features such as the hollow core piston, built in dynamic balancer, and bottom bypass cooling system.
The manual is split by system, with dedicated chapters for the engine body, lubricating system, cooling system, fuel system, and electrical system, plus general servicing and troubleshooting up front.
Owners and independent mechanics can use it to trace fuel and cooling faults, torque the cylinder head and main bearings, set valve clearance, and overhaul these three and four cylinder diesels to factory figures. Servicing specifications and clearance limits back up each procedure.

Quick Reference Specifications
| Specification | Value | Page |
|---|---|---|
| Main bearing case screw 2 | 68.6 to 73.5 N·m | p. 84 |
| Replacing fuel filter cartridge | 400 hrs | p. 33 |
| Injection pipe retaining nut | 24.5 to 34.3 N·m | p. 21 |
| Cylinder Head Surface Flatness | 0.05 mm | p. 25 |
| Injection Pressure | 13.73 MPa (140 kgf/cm², 1991 psi) | p. 6 |
| Engine Weight (Dry, D1503-M) | 148 kg (326 lbs) | p. 6 |
| Lubricating Oil Capacity (V2403-M, 124 mm pan) | 9.5 L (2.51 U.S.gals) | p. 7 |
| Flywheel Screw Tightening Torque | 98.1 to 107.9 N·m | p. 21 |
| Connecting Rod Screw Tightening Torque | 44.1 to 49.0 N·m | p. 21 |
| Valve Clearance (Cold) | 0.18 to 0.22 mm | p. 25 |
| Engine Oil Pressure (At Rated Speed) | 294 to 441 kPa | p. 31 |
| Thermostat Opening Temperature (Beginning) | 69.5 to 72.5 °C | p. 31 |
Kubota 03-M Series Common Problems This Manual Covers
Running rough and losing power
Clogged or water contaminated fuel filters, from moisture building up in steel tanks, leave the engine running rough and down on power. The fuel system chapter covers the filter, injection pump, and nozzle service.
Manual Section: Fuel System p. 112Water in cylinders and hydrostatic lock
Rainwater entering through the exhaust can fill a cylinder and lock the engine, leaving water in the oil. The engine body procedures cover the inspection and the repair that follows.
Manual Section: Engine Body p. 67Cylinder wall wear or damage
Excessive wear or a crack into the water jacket can require sleeving rather than a simple bore. The engine body chapter gives the inspection and the servicing limits.
Manual Section: Engine Body p. 67Engine runaway after pump work
A stuck injection pump section can leave the engine revving high with no throttle response and no shutdown from the key. The fuel system chapter covers injection pump service and adjustment.
Manual Section: Fuel System p. 112Engine overheating
A stuck thermostat, a slipping fan belt, or a failing radiator cap drives the temperature up. The cooling system chapter covers the bottom bypass system, thermostat, radiator, and coolant checks.
Manual Section: Cooling System p. 109Low engine oil pressure
A worn oil pump rotor or clogged filter drops oil pressure and risks bearing damage. The lubricating system chapter covers oil pressure, the filter cartridge, and rotor lobe clearance.
Manual Section: Lubricating System p. 107Charging and starting faults
A weak glow plug, alternator, or starter shows up as hard cold starting or a flat battery. The electrical system chapter covers checking, disassembly, and servicing of these parts.

Which engines does this manual cover?
It covers the Kubota 03-M Series diesel engines, including the D1503-M, D1703-M, D1803-M, V2203-M, and V2403-M, under publication 9Y011-02132.
What is the cylinder head bolt torque?
The cylinder head screw tightening torque is 93.2 to 98.1 N·m. The Engine Body chapter lists it with the checking, adjusting, and assembly procedures. p. 67
What is the cold valve clearance?
Valve clearance when cold is 0.18 to 0.22 mm. The servicing specifications up front give the value and the maintenance context for setting it. p. 16
